Charlie Woods: A Rising Star

While Tiger Woods took pride in his daughter’s achievements, his son, Charlie Woods, made headlines of his own at the Team TaylorMade Invitational. Following an impressive round, Charlie finished just three shots off the lead, showcasing his burgeoning skills on the golf course. With a score of 70 (2-under), he ranked fourteenth out of a field of 72 players at the Streamsong Resort’s Black Course in Bowling Green, Florida.

Competing Among the Best: The Field at the Invitational

Charlie Woods faced tough competition, notably from fellow golfers Tyler Watts and Luke Colton, who blazed ahead with a score of 67 (5-under) to lead the tournament. Both are ranked in the AJGA Top 10 for junior boys, emphasizing the high-caliber nature of the event. Despite entering the tournament ranked No. 604, Charlie’s performance emphasizes that talent knows no rankings; it’s all about execution on the day.

Strong Local Presence: Palm Beach County Golfers Shine

Along with Charlie, several golfers from Palm Beach County made their mark at the Team TaylorMade Invitational. Pavel Tsar, a former Benjamin golf teammate and a Notre Dame signee, also tied for fourteenth with a score of 70, proving to be a strong and consistent player. Additionally, Giuseppe Puebla from Royal Palm Beach finished with an even-par 72, showcasing the talent that flourishes within the region.
